Aprilia RS 660 and RS 457 Lead Italy’s Sports Bike Market

Lightweight performance machines dominate with over 21% market share and growing global demand.

Aprilia continues to assert its dominance in the sports bike segment, with the RS 660 and RS 457 emerging as the best-selling sports motorcycles in Italy. Together, the two models account for more than 21% of the market share, highlighting the brand’s strong position in the small and mid-displacement category.

The success is not limited to Italy. Aprilia’s RS range has also gained significant traction in international markets, particularly in the United States, where the brand recorded double-digit growth over the past year, and across Europe, where the RS 660 remains one of the top-selling sportbikes.

A winning formula: lightweight, performance, and accessibility

Aprilia’s approach to modern sportbikes has played a key role in this achievement. By focusing on lightweight construction, high-performance engines, and advanced electronics, the Italian manufacturer has created motorcycles that are both accessible to new riders and exciting for experienced enthusiasts.

The RS range represents a new generation of sportbikes designed not only for track performance but also for everyday usability. This balance has made models like the RS 660 and RS 457 highly appealing to a wide range of riders.

RS 660 continues to set the benchmark

The Aprilia RS 660 remains a standout model in the segment, consistently topping sales charts in Italy. Often regarded as the pioneer of the modern midweight sportbike category, the RS 660 blends performance, comfort, and cutting-edge technology.

Its success is also reflected on the track, with strong performances in championships such as MotoAmerica’s Twin Cup and the British Superbike SportBike class. Looking ahead, the RS 660 is set to compete in the World Superbike Championship’s new SportBike class in 2026, further reinforcing its racing credentials.

The model has also proven its capabilities in real-world conditions, highlighted by an impressive lap time set during the Aprilia All Stars event at Misano, achieved on a standard production bike.

RS 457 targets the next generation of riders

Positioned as an entry point into the Aprilia sportbike family, the RS 457 has quickly gained popularity, particularly among younger riders.

Built on an entirely new platform, the RS 457 combines lightweight design, user-friendly handling, and advanced technology. Its twin-cylinder engine delivers the maximum power allowed for A2 riders, while maintaining an excellent power-to-weight ratio.

With features such as ride-by-wire throttle, multiple riding modes, traction control, and optional quickshifter, the RS 457 offers a premium riding experience in a highly accessible package. The model is also available in a GP Replica version, inspired by Aprilia’s MotoGP machinery.

Global growth driven by racing success

Aprilia’s growing success in the sportbike segment is closely tied to its strong presence in MotoGP, where the brand achieved its best-ever results in 2025. Strong performances on the world stage have helped boost the appeal of its road-going models, particularly the RS lineup.

In Europe, Aprilia has emerged as a leading manufacturer in the fully-faired sportbike category, while in the US, it continues to gain ground as one of the fastest-growing brands in the segment.

With the RS 660 and RS 457 leading the charge, Aprilia is proving that modern sportbikes can be lightweight, technologically advanced, and accessible, without having to compromise performance or riding excitement.
